Names and Functions of

Components

■ Lens

2

3

4

1 Lens surface

2 Focus ring

Rotate the focus ring when manually focusing the

camera.

3 Focus distance indicator

Indicates the distance from the subject (a rough

indicator of the focus range). Use it as a guide when
manually focusing the camera or taking close-ups.

4 Lens fitting mark

5 Contact point

6 Aperture ring button

To switch the aperture ring from manual ([1.4] to

[16]) to automatic [A] (or vice versa), rotate it while
pressing the aperture ring button.

7 Aperture ring

Rotate the aperture ring when you wish to make

large or small adjustments to the aperture value or

to switch to auto adjustment.

• When using a camera on which the aperture ring

does not function, refer to the camera's operating

instructions for how to operate the aperture.
(The position of the aperture ring does not affect

the operation.)
